Upon entering a textile production line, it's immediately apparent that the fabrics are laid properly. This stage directly impacts the quality of all subsequent processes. Any errors made during the laying process will reverberate at every stage, from cutting to sewing. This is why laying systems are considered one of the most critical links in the production chain.

Fabric spreading used to be done entirely manually. However, manual spreading was both time-consuming and prone to errors. Uneven layers, fabric shifting, or misalignment caused waste in production. The emergence of industrial solutions eliminated these problems, leading to a significant leap in production efficiency. Spreading Technologies Compatible with Different Fabric Types

The fabric types used in textile production are quite wide. Knitted fabrics, woven fabrics, elastic fabrics, and technical textiles... Each presents its own unique challenges during the spreading process. Mersmann spreading systems are designed to meet this diversity.

For example, elastic fabrics can easily slip or stretch during manual spreading. However, Mersmann machines prevent these problems by spreading the fabric in a controlled manner. Furthermore, thick and heavy technical textiles are aligned properly thanks to specialized transport and spreading modules. This flexibility allows manufacturers to address a wide range of product groups with a single machine.

Advantages of Digital Control and Automation

One of the greatest innovations technology has brought to the textile industry is digitalization. Mersmann spreading systems minimize operator errors thanks to advanced control panels and automation features.

These machines, integrated with CAD software, can directly implement cutting plans created in a computer environment. The direction in which the fabric will be laid, the number of layers, and how it will be transferred to the cutting line are all pre-programmed. This way, the operator simply monitors the process, while the system handles all operations automatically. This integration ensures speed and accuracy, as well as continuity in production.

Contributions to Labor and Cost Savings

Labor is often the largest component of production costs. While manual spreading requires multiple people to work, Mersmann spreading machines significantly reduce this need. Hundreds of meters of fabric can be spread in minutes under the control of a single operator.

This not only saves labor but also reduces waste. Because the fabric layers are laid perfectly aligned, there is no additional loss during cutting. In the long run, the machines quickly recoup their investment cost. This translates into a sustainable competitive advantage for businesses.
